A special discussion on the work of Robert Chanbers, drawing from Ken Hites’s research for his new annotation of The King in Yellow. Where did black stars rise before they hung over Carcosa? What inspired the King in Yellow, whom emperors have served? Whither syphillis? Robert W. Chambers’ “The King in Yellow” has inspired horror authors from Lovecraft to the present darkening day. Kenneth Hite, annotator of Arc Dream Publishing’s new “The King in Yellow: Annotated Edition,” dives deep into the cloud-waves of Hali for the origins, evolution, and influence of Chambers’ haunting tales.

Panelists: Ken Hite, Shane Ivey, James Lowder, Nicole Cushing, and Silvia Moreno Garcia.
